Output f0d525ca04156dfc70c1007f334b9a99a44394d7539916b9462d3059eae75e90:13

value
1499257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4d21c00570ec033a3bab3daa7526bffdb2ab04c OP_EQUAL
address
3M6JssGRT7WcTg3qbtaDZJybi6CEvxskmg
transaction
f0d525ca04156dfc70c1007f334b9a99a44394d7539916b9462d3059eae75e90
spent
true